PM Modi Condoles Demise of Former Union Minister Kabindra Purkayastha

RR Team, January 7, 2026January 7, 2026
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i on Wednesday expressed deep grief over the demise of former Member of Parliament and Union Minister Shri Kabindra Purkayastha Ji. The Prime Minister described the loss as deeply painful and paid rich tributes to the veteran leader’s lifelong dedication to public service and his significant contribution to the development of Assam.
Shri Purkayastha, a respected political figure from Assam, was known for his unwavering commitment to society and his role in strengthening democratic and organisational structures in the region.

PM Modi Pays Tribute on Social Media

In a message shared on social media platform X, Prime Minister Modi said he was pained by the passing of Shri Kabindra Purkayastha Ji and highlighted his lasting legacy in Assam’s political and social landscape.

The Prime Minister noted that Shri Purkayastha’s contribution towards the progress of Assam would always be remembered and acknowledged his crucial role in strengthening the Bharatiya Janata Party across the state.

Message in English and Assamese Reflects Deep Respect

In a rare gesture underscoring his personal connection with the people of the Northeast, the Prime Minister expressed his condolences both in English and Assamese. In his Assamese message, he reaffirmed Shri Purkayastha’s dedication to social service and his enduring impact on Assam’s development.

The bilingual tribute resonated strongly with party workers and citizens across the state, reflecting the late leader’s deep roots in Assam’s public life.

A Life Dedicated to Public Service

Shri Kabindra Purkayastha served as a Member of Parliament and held responsibilities as a Union Minister, during which he earned a reputation as a disciplined, approachable and principled leader.

Colleagues and contemporaries often described him as a bridge between grassroots aspirations and national policymaking, particularly in ensuring that the concerns of Assam received due attention at the Centre.

Strengthening the BJP in Assam

Prime Minister Modi specifically recalled Shri Purkayastha’s role in strengthening the Bharatiya Janata Party’s organisational base in Assam. His efforts helped expand the party’s presence and fostered a culture of discipline and service among workers.

Senior BJP leaders have acknowledged that his groundwork played an important role in shaping the party’s growth in the state over the years.

Condolences Pour In

Following the Prime Minister’s message, several political leaders, party workers and citizens expressed condolences, remembering Shri Purkayastha as a leader who remained committed to public welfare throughout his career.

Tributes highlighted his humility, accessibility and ability to connect with people from all walks of life, traits that earned him respect beyond party lines.

Nation Remembers a Dedicated Leader

The passing of Shri Kabindra Purkayastha Ji marks the end of an important chapter in Assam’s political history. His legacy continues through the institutions he strengthened and the values he upheld in public life.
